		<description>This app sucks.
Installed it on my phoned and loved the usability. Was thoroughly enjoying it until 2 days later when my batter on my Blackberry, which normally lasts a week, was completely flat. Charged it fully not knowing what was up and two days later again BOOM it was flat.

This thing drained my batter life like crazy - I&#039;m GUESSING it must have been checking gmails servers frequently to see if I had new mail and so that was making my usage of the phone in effect tripple or more. If its checking it every 20 mins then that means every 20 mins its using power to connect to the internet and start doing work - normally it does no work and just sits in my pocket until I make a call on it.</description>
